Generate TypeScript MCP Server
Create a complete Model Context Protocol (MCP) server in TypeScript with the following specifications:
Requirements
Project Structure
Create a new TypeScript/Node.js project with proper directory structure
NPM Packages
Include @modelcontextprotocol/sdk, zod@3, and either express (for HTTP) or stdio support
TypeScript Configuration
Proper tsconfig.json with ES modules support
Server Type
Choose between HTTP (with Streamable HTTP transport) or stdio-based server
Tools
Create at least one useful tool with proper schema validation
Error Handling
Include comprehensive error handling and validation Implementation Details Project Setup Initialize with npm init and create package.json Install dependencies: @modelcontextprotocol/sdk , zod@3 , and transport-specific packages Configure TypeScript with ES modules: "type": "module" in package.json Add dev dependencies: tsx or ts-node for development Create proper .gitignore file Server Configuration Use McpServer class for high-level implementation Set server name and version Choose appropriate transport (StreamableHTTPServerTransport or StdioServerTransport) For HTTP: set up Express with proper middleware and error handling For stdio: use StdioServerTransport directly Tool Implementation Use registerTool() method with descriptive names Define schemas using zod for input and output validation Provide clear title and description fields Return both content and structuredContent in results Implement proper error handling with try-catch blocks Support async operations where appropriate Resource/Prompt Setup (Optional) Add resources using registerResource() with ResourceTemplate for dynamic URIs Add prompts using registerPrompt() with argument schemas Consider adding completion support for better UX Code Quality Use TypeScript for type safety Follow async/await patterns consistently Implement proper cleanup on transport close events Use environment variables for configuration Add inline comments for complex logic Structure code with clear separation of concerns Example Tool Types to Consider Data processing and transformation External API integrations File system operations (read, search, analyze) Database queries Text analysis or summarization (with sampling) System information retrieval Configuration Options For HTTP Servers : Port configuration via environment variables CORS setup for browser clients Session management (stateless vs stateful) DNS rebinding protection for local servers For stdio Servers : Proper stdin/stdout handling Environment-based configuration Process lifecycle management Testing Guidance Explain how to run the server ( npm start or npx tsx server.ts ) Provide MCP Inspector command: npx @modelcontextprotocol/inspector For HTTP servers, include connection URL: http://localhost:PORT/mcp Include example tool invocations Add troubleshooting tips for common issues Additional Features to Consider Sampling support for LLM-powered tools User input elicitation for interactive workflows Dynamic tool registration with enable/disable capabilities Notification debouncing for bulk updates Resource links for efficient data references Generate a complete, production-ready MCP server with comprehensive documentation, type safety, and error handling.
